| Route Notes | BC 28/04 4900m ABC 28/04 5700m C1 02/05 6400m Smt 07/05 by Jornet at 3 pm (summit was in cloud so Jornet is not 100% sure whether he reached the right point as Everest was obviously not visible. (Billi Bierling believes that he reached the right point though as he had walked on the plateau for about 30 minutes). On 3 May Jornet and Forsberg reached 7500m during their first summit push, but turned back because of the weather. They returned to ABC. They rested for a couple of days and went back to C1 on 6 May. Jornet and Forsberg started at 1 am from 6400m. Forsberg turned back at around 7700m at 11 am. It started to snow and the Yellow Band had not been fixed and it was very icy. She felt that she could probably go up, but would struggle to come down. She descended to ABC. Jornet continued and reached summit at 3 pm. He spent about 10 minutes on the summit and descended to C1, picked up the tent that Forsberg had packed up and descended to ABC, where he reached at 6:30 pm. Oxygen: not taken, not used. Note: Jornet later acknowledged to Outside Magazine that he stopped at the summit plateau as that was enough since he was training for Everest. |
